The liturgical cord, or cingulum, is one of the essential accessories for a communion alb. It symbolizes God's power and grace. When buying a communion outfit, it is worth thinking about additional elements right away - this way, we can be sure that everything matches and forms a coherent whole. The tradition of wearing a liturgical cord is extremely long. Currently, it is used not only by clergy, but also as an accessory to the communion alb. The MK Maryla range includes liturgical cords that will perfectly complement any outfit. The model presented here is a beautiful white and silver liturgical cord. It has tassels at both ends. The careful workmanship makes the cingulum look beautiful. The white and silver color scheme perfectly complements white albs and those with silver trim. In addition to referring to tradition, the liturgical cord emphasizes the waist. It is an accessory that makes the alb fit better and look more attractive. The appropriate length ensures comfort for the child.
